    I just wanted to say thanks in a way that others can view. On 6/27/24, I was traveling with my son…read moreto a college baseball camp. I noticed a noise in my engine and shortly after the A/C went out in my 2004 H2 Hummer. I looked at the engine to find my A/C belt was off and bound up. At ~2 pm on a Thursday, I found Gerard's Automotive Shop and hoped for the best as I was 2 hours from home with work at 8 am the next day and unsure how safe it was to continue driving. They were busy servicing many customers. I asked for help, and I was politely told they were backed up but would take a look in ~45 minutes. ~30 minutes later they took that look and quickly found that the tensioner had gone bad on my A/C unit which caused my belt to slip and bind. Within 2 hours I was taken care of for less than $200. Furthermore, they identified an oil leak, took pics, and sent them to me. The owner chatted with me and my son, gave us cold water and a cookie while we waited. How long has it been in your life since you had such great service as a non-existing client/customer? It's been quite some time for me. I can't thank these guys enough as they not only saved me a ton of time, worries and money, I now know when I travel from Atlanta suburbia for a Harrah's Cherokee Valley River Casino run, I have a trusty mechanic close by when/if I need it. I may just strategize a service visit or repair when I visit the casino just because I know I'll get great service and a fair shake. There are still some good folks out there, and I can vouch that these guys are of that group. Sincerely, Dr. Michael J. Grasso
